#imports
source("staging/fm-binclass.dml") as fm_binclass
# generate dummy data ( this is just a sample! )
n = 1000; d = 7; k=2;
X = rand(rows=n, cols=d);
y = round(rand(rows=n, cols=1));
X_val = rand(rows=100, cols=7);
y_val = round(rand(rows=100, cols=1));
# Train
[w0, W, V, loss] = fm_binclass::train(X, y, X_val, y_val);
# Write model out
#write(w0, out_dir+"/w0");
#write(W, out_dir+"/W");
#write(V, out_dir+"/V");
# eval on test set
probs = fm_binclass::predict(X, w0, W, V);
[loss, accuracy] = fm_binclass::eval(probs, y);
# Output results
print("Test Accuracy: " + accuracy)
#write(accuracy, out_dir+"/accuracy")
print("")
